Job SummaryPerforms daily imaging and delivers daily prescribed therapeutic radiation doses to radiation therapy patients safely and accurately. The therapist incorporates their technical knowledge of the equipment and expertise of clinical treatment set‑up, anatomical landmarks, treatment recording and management during patient care. The therapist must be able to interact effectively and accurately with patients and their family members, physicians, healthcare workers, and radiation oncology department personnel.
Possesses the skills and knowledge necessary to be proficient in accurate delivery of prescribed doses of radiation, safety of patient during treatment, and documentation of patient care in the patient treatment record and inpatient chart (if applicable). A patient's sensitivity and confidentiality must be practiced at all times with adherence all HIPAA compliance standards. The therapist develops an understanding of the patient's physical and emotional status and reports that to the appropriate staff.
Ability to work with growth and development needs of all client populations.
- Completion of radiation therapy course from an approved school or accredited program.
- Registration with the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) is required. If working in North Dakota and performing medical imaging or radiation therapy procedures, licensure through the North Dakota Medical Imaging and Radiation Therapy (NDMIRT) Board of Examiners is required.
